Abstract
Overview
ISO 2975-7:1977 specifies the transit time method using radioactive tracers for measuring water flow rate in closed conduits (pipe flow). Part VII of the ISO 2975 series, it describes the principle of labelling fluid parcels with a radioactive tracer, recording concentration/time distributions at two detector cross‑sections spaced a known distance apart, and deriving flow rate from the tracer transit time. The method applies where a tracer solution can be injected and effectively mixed with the conduit flow - adequate mixing being fundamental to valid results.
Key topics and technical requirements
- Principle: Measure the transit time of labelled fluid particles between two detector positions; flow rate Q = V / t where V is volume between detectors and t is transit time.
